腾讯云
开发者社区
文档
建议反馈
控制台
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
登录/注册
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
2
回答
为什么
在
textViewDidBeginEditing
之前
调用
观察者
onKeyboardDisplayed
swift
、
uitextview
、
uikeyboard
、
uitextviewdelegate
我的App
在
swift中。当我编辑UITextField时,有时键盘会隐藏该字段。然后
在
viewDidLoad上,我添加了一个链接到
onKeyboardDisplayed
函数的
观察者
,我
在
该函数中测试"activeTextField“的值,以便在需要时向上滑动屏幕。它工作得很好:) 坏消息是,我尝试对委托做同样的事情,使用UITextView
textViewDidBeginEditing
来设置一个"activeTextView“。但与UITextField不同的是,
浏览 24
提问于2020-12-23
得票数 1
回答已采纳
2
回答
UIKeyboardWillChangeFrameNotification
在
textViewDidBeginEditing
之前
打电话,但在textFieldDidBeginEditing之后打电话?
为什么
?
ios
、
cocoa-touch
、
uitextfield
、
uitextview
我的ViewController中有下面的
观察者
。UIKeyboardWillChangeFrameNotification object:nil]; 该视图控制器还符合UITextFieldDelegate和UITextViewDelegate,并实现了textFieldDidBeginEditing和
textViewDidBeginEditing
如果点击UITextField,
调用
顺序是textFieldDidBeginEditing,然后是keyboardWillChangeFrame:。如果您点击UITextView,
调用<
浏览 1
提问于2015-05-19
得票数 3
2
回答
当键盘显示一个文本视图而不是另一个文本视图时,如何移动视图
ios
、
swift
、
xcode
、
uiview
、
uitextview
== 0 self.view.frame.origin.y -= keyboardSize.height } func
textViewDidBeginEditing
浏览 1
提问于2020-04-16
得票数 1
回答已采纳
2
回答
IOS textView委派
ios
、
objective-c
、
uitextview
、
uitextviewdelegate
我希望
在
UIKeyboardWillShowNotification委托
之前
单击textview时获得事件。现在,当我单击textview时,is
调用
UIKeyboardWillShowNotification。在那之后,它叫- (void)
textViewDidBeginEditing
:(UITextView *)textView,这不好!我想在
调用
UIKeyboardWillShowNotification
之前
调用
mytextview delegate 如何解决此问
浏览 3
提问于2015-11-25
得票数 0
1
回答
在
UITextView中移动光标
objective-c
、
ios
、
cocoa-touch
、
uitextview
我尝试
在
选择(触摸) UITextView时移动光标,以模拟某种UITextField placeholder事件。- (void)
textViewDidBeginEditing
:(UITex
浏览 1
提问于2012-02-19
得票数 2
2
回答
为什么
我需要在我观察到的对象被取消分配
之前
删除一个通知
观察者
?
cocoa-touch
、
nsnotificationcenter
来自 您必须
调用
removeObserver:或远程
观察者
:名称:对象:
在
addObserverForName: object :queue:usingBlock: is deallocated指定的任何对象
之前
调用
为什么
在
我所观察到的通知被取消
之前
停止观察是重要的?我理解
为什么
我作为
观察者
必须停止观察,如果我要消失,这个块取决于我的存在,但我不明白
为什么
观测对象的寿命重要。我是不是曲解了这个?
浏览 3
提问于2013-01-05
得票数 3
回答已采纳
4
回答
检测启动和停止编辑UITextView
iphone
、
objective-c
、
uitextview
、
editing
如何在输入UITextView (用户点击编辑它)和离开视图(用户点击离开它)时
调用
一些代码? 感谢任何人的帮助。
浏览 1
提问于2010-11-09
得票数 34
回答已采纳
3
回答
仅在插入视图和加载内容时才执行处理程序
ember.js
、
ember-data
通过存储完全加载arrayController内容 console.info('inserted the element and store is loaded');}, 当我
在
didInsertElement方法之外设置
观察者
浏览 4
提问于2013-01-10
得票数 4
1
回答
清除强有力的引用是正确的模式吗?
ios
、
swift
、
automatic-ref-counting
、
retain-cycle
、
deinit
有几种资源(、,加上我在任何地方都见过它)建议将
观察者
从deinit of UIViewController的NotificationCenter中移除,例如: NotificationCenter.default.removeObservername: NSNotification.Name.UIKeyboardWillHide, object: nil)现在,虽然根据,我不需要考虑从NotificationCenter中删除一个
观察者
根据官方的
在
类实例被解除分配
之前
,将立即
调
浏览 3
提问于2017-12-10
得票数 1
回答已采纳
4
回答
Swift财产
观察者
,初始值
swift
苹果公司的文档称: enum State {}var state: State= .disabled {
浏览 0
提问于2018-02-21
得票数 2
回答已采纳
3
回答
观察者
模式负债:
为什么
观察者
要改变它的主题?
design-patterns
在
阅读一篇关于
观察者
模式的文章时,我发现下面列出了
观察者
模式的责任。Pls让我通过一个示例还指定了
为什么
subject可以限制
浏览 1
提问于2012-04-03
得票数 4
5
回答
为什么
我需要在通知
观察者
之前
调用
setChanged?
java
我不明白的是:
在
通知
观察者
(notifyObservers())
之前
,我必须
调用
setChanged()。
在
notifyObservers方法中有一个需要我们
调用
setChanged的布尔值。
为什么
我必须
调用
setChanged()?
浏览 0
提问于2013-02-28
得票数 27
回答已采纳
1
回答
计算属性上的Ember.js
观察者
,不工作。指南中的例子
ember.js
在
向
观察者
回调添加了一个警报语句之后,我惊讶地发现它没有被
调用
。 person.get('fullName');有人能解释一下这是怎么回事吗?编辑 我已经对代码进行了更多的跟踪,现在我了解了
为什么
这种行为可能是这样的。我早些时候观察到,如果我叫"ge
浏览 3
提问于2013-10-13
得票数 6
回答已采纳
1
回答
在
objective-c中不单击文本视图时,Uitextview文本为空
objective-c
、
ios5
我正在使用UITextView,当我修改textview并获得文本时,它的委托方法
调用
得很好。它工作得很好。当我不修改文本视图文本时,我得到了空值。请告诉我任何建议。 提前谢谢。
浏览 0
提问于2013-03-23
得票数 0
回答已采纳
3
回答
为什么
Android体系结构组件的
观察者
中的值param是可空的?
android
、
kotlin
、
android-architecture-components
、
android-livedata
* @param t The new data void onChanged(@Nullable T t);
为什么
有一个显式的可空注释?LiveData.observe()的医生还说: 代码似乎就是这样工作的。我理解
为什么
这不适用于LiveData.getValue(),
在</e
浏览 1
提问于2018-05-11
得票数 9
回答已采纳
1
回答
为什么
当多次
调用
setValue()时,MutableLiveData
观察者
只
调用
一次?
android
、
android-livedata
,将从主线程
调用
此函数(
在
ViewModel中)以更新视图状态对象(以显示Snackbar,但随后重置状态以使其不会重新显示): @UiThread private fun onFailure() {MutableLiveData.setValue()
在
两个突变后都没有触发
观察者
?如果有活动的
观察者
,该值将被分派给他们。”但很难不得出结论,情况并非如此,因为setValue()正在被
调用
,但是
观察者
(它是活动的)没有被触发。
观察者
肯定是
在</e
浏览 215
提问于2019-02-21
得票数 1
2
回答
如何在Magento中设置事件
观察者
的排序顺序?
magento
、
events
、
observers
我已经
在
catalog_product_save_after事件上创建了一个
观察者
,但它似乎在运行applyAllRulesOnProduct()方法的catalogrule
观察者
之前
被
调用
。我需要在applyAllRulesOnProduct()运行后
调用
我的。这些
观察者
的顺序是如何选择的?
浏览 3
提问于2013-04-11
得票数 14
回答已采纳
7
回答
观测器设计模式
java
、
design-patterns
、
observer-pattern
在
观察者
设计模式中,主题通过
调用
每个
观察者
的update()操作通知所有
观察者
。这样做的一个方法是 for (observer: observers) { }但是这里的问题是,每个
观察者
都是按顺序更新的,
在
更新
之前
可能不会
调用
一个
观察者
的更新操作。如果有一个具有无限循环进行更新的
观察者
,那么它
浏览 4
提问于2009-12-07
得票数 5
回答已采纳
6
回答
C++基类析构函数顺序问题
c++
、
class
、
destructor
有人知道
在
基类析构函数被
调用
之前
,我可以使用什么技巧来保留派生类吗?Event类提供了一个
观察者
类。class A : public Event::Observer 然后删除类A的一个实例,当~
观察者
自动删除连接到这个
观察者
的任何信号时。但是由于类A
在
观察者
之前
被销毁,如果不同线程上的东西
在
~A之后和~
观察者
之前
调用
A上的槽,则会被
调用</
浏览 1
提问于2010-07-21
得票数 2
回答已采纳
3
回答
NSNotificationCenter removeObserver:
在
dealloc和线程安全方面
objective-c
、
memory-management
、
automatic-ref-counting
、
nsnotificationcenter
我使用ARC,我
在
观察者
的dealloc中
调用
了dealloc。来自 Q1:NSNotificationCenter线程安全吗?在这种情况下,
观察者
被解除
浏览 5
提问于2012-12-17
得票数 6
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
详解设计模式:观察者模式
响应式编程和Rxjs库介绍
彻底搞懂RxJS中的Subjects
Vue源码分析之 Watcher和Dep
观察者模式VS发布-订阅模式
热门
标签
更多标签
活动推荐
运营活动
广告
关闭
领券